## Deploying the Gatewick Proctor Queue

Deploys are pretty painless: push to main, wait for the pipeline, then watch the queue drain dashboard for five minutes. If candidates pile up mid-exam, roll back first and ask questions later — the queue replays safely. Everything the workers care about lives in one config block, shown here for reference.

settings of bafof-yagef:
JOROX_PIN=8740
JOROX_TENANT=pelox
JOROX_METRICS_HOST=metrics.jorox.qorvelworks.internal
JOROX_SEAL=seal_c78f63c1
JOROX_STANDBY_TEAM=norax

Ticket #snapshot-vault-locked

Priority: high. The Pinwheel snapshot-testing vault rejected three unlock attempts after last night's CI run and is now hard-locked. All UI component baselines (buttons, modals, the Glimmerbar) are inaccessible, so snapshot diffs are failing across every branch. Do not retry the normal unlock — it extends the lockout. Use the break-glass flow from the on-call runbook. The override prompt expects the vault recovery passphrase, printed just below.

unlock words, hahip-baduf: holwyn-istath-julvan

## Deployment

The Tollgrove tax-rate cache deploys as a single stateless container behind the regional balancer. Warm the cache before routing traffic: run the preload job, which pulls the full jurisdiction table from the rates authority and verifies row counts against the manifest. Blue-green only — never in-place, since eviction timers reset on restart and a cold cache will hammer the upstream. TTLs differ per jurisdiction tier; do not flatten them. The deployment reads these configuration values at startup:

config for kafof-bawef:
holath:
  log_level: debug
  metrics_host: metrics.holath.qorvelsys.internal
  pin: 2191
  pool_size: 32

## Runbook: Blue-Green Deploy — Ledgerline Billing Worker

Plugin authors: during a blue-green cutover, both worker colors may briefly process events, so ensure your plugin's handlers are idempotent. The deploy tool shifts the invoice queue to green, drains blue for five minutes, then retires it. To watch the cutover yourself, query the Switchyard status API, which requires the shared observer service key shown below.

gateway credential: kto23_LX9A4ys6i4nzHtpOLNLodKK